House hacking in San Mateo (Hillsdale / Bay Meadows / Laurelwood).

The strongest catalyst pillar of the San Mateo ZIPs: delivered grade-separated Caltrain, a 1,250-unit TOD under construction, and an in-ZIP Fortune-league employer, held to A by a ~$2.0M median. The Bay Meadows condo and townhome pocket is the sub-median entry.

What's actually happening in 94403

  • Delivered

    Hillsdale Caltrain rebuild plus the 25th Ave Grade Separation: $205.9M, delivered (station reopened Apr 2021, project complete Sept 2021). Caltrain

  • Under construction

    Bay Meadows Phase II: an 83-acre TOD with 1,250 units plus 1.25M sq ft office and parks, roughly two-thirds built. City of San Mateo

  • Existing anchor

    Franklin Templeton global HQ (~12,000 employees), the San Mateo anchor employer. Franklin Templeton

  • Early entitlement

    Hillsdale Mall redevelopment: early entitlement, ~1,392 homes proposed (~20% of the city RHNA); speculative upside only. City of San Mateo

The numbers

Median price
~$2.0M (Redfin, 3 months ending May 2026)
Market rent
~$3,500/mo avg, 2bd ~$3,999 (Zumper)
Property tax (San Mateo County)
1.26% combined effective average (range 1.08–1.52% by tax-rate area; purchase resets the assessed basis to sale price)
Per-bed rent band
$1,200–1,700/mo per bed
ADU rent band
$2,600–3,200/mo
Whole-home rent band
$4,300–5,200/mo whole-home
Underwriting vacancy
3–4% underwriting vacancy
Appreciation scenarios
3.0 / 4.5 / 6.0 %/yr (conservative / base / upside)

Bay Meadows condos and townhomes trade well below the SFR median; AB 1482 plus mild Nov 2025 relocation and rehab-notice ordinances. Appreciation basis: The delivered grade separation plus Bay Meadows under construction; enter via the condo pocket. The house-hack angle

A Bay Meadows condo or townhome as the affordable entry near the grade-separated station; SFR plus ADU on the Hillsdale, Laurelwood, and Sugarloaf tracts.

What breaks it

  • A ~$2.0M median compresses the S&P math outside the condo pocket
  • Franklin Templeton consolidation risk on the jobs leg
  • Hillsdale Mall is early and preliminary; Sugarloaf hillside slope constrains ADU adds
